Sydney siege: reports of hostage situation inside Martin Place cafe


A GUNMAN is reportedly holding people hostage at a cafe in Sydney’s Martin Place.
Channel 7 reported that an armed man is holding hostages at the Lindt Chocolate cafe, opposite the broadcaster’s Martin Place studios.
A NSW Police spokeswoman told Guardian Australia police were responding to an “unfolding” situation in Martin Place.
She would not confirm social media reports that a gunman was in the area, merely that it was an “ongoing operation.”
